    gdb, remote: adjust debug printing
    
    remote::wait () may get called rather frequently, polluting the logging
    output with tons of
    
        [remote] wait: enter
        [remote] wait: exit
    
    messages.
    
    Similarly, remote_target::remote_notif_remove_queued_reply () will print
    the debug message even if nothing was actually removed.  Change that to
    only print a debug message if a stop reply was removed.
